Visual Studio 2019中的Git同步

问题描述 投票:1回答:1

我正在使用Visual Studio 2019中的Sync操作从git服务器获取工件。我知道Sync首先要执行pull操作,然后是对git服务器的push操作;但就我而言,它无法按预期工作。

如果我按同步,我会收到此消息

“

但是在此之后,如果我按Fetch,即使看到2个传入的提交,我也希望传入的提交什么都看不到。

对此行为有任何想法吗?

git tfs visual-studio-2019 git-push git-pull
1个回答
0
投票

正如yan所评论的,您应该首先检查它是否稳定。如果您可以稳定地重现此问题。

  • sync:执行git pullgit push
  • fetch:执行git fetch,从中检索所有提交您的遥控器而不合并它们。

这不是预期的行为。您可以使用git reflog命令跟踪日志并检查是否有一些有用的信息。

您也可以尝试使用由其他服务器托管的远程git repo,例如GitHub。如果这是客户端问题,它将缩小范围。

也可以将您的VS2019升级到最新版本,这可以解决问题。

© www.soinside.com 2019 - 2024. All rights reserved.